Key Responsibilities

โš™๏ธ Mechanized Outreach & Data Orchestration

  • Design and operate scalable, automated outreach systems using tools like Clay, internal data sources, and APIs.
  • Integrate data from platforms like LinkedIn Insights, Yelp API, and ZoomInfo to create enriched lead personas.

๐Ÿง  Intelligent Personalization & Campaign Support

  • Enable upstream personalization using custom objects in Salesforce and Clay workflows.
  • Build personalized lead flows and assets that power regional and lifecycle campaigns.

๐Ÿ“ฌ Lead Distribution & Deliverability

  • Build multi-inbox routing workflows to ensure optimal deliverability.
  • Implement automated systems for lead validation, fallback generation, and equitable distribution (e.g., round-robin).

๐Ÿ”„ Cross-Functional Collaboration

  • Collaborate closely with regional marketing teams to support inbound and outbound campaign plays, ABM, and event follow-ups.
  • Sync campaign performance, enriched data, and workflows across CRM and sales enablement tools (e.g., Salesforce, Outreach).

๐Ÿ”” Recommendation Engine & Smart Alerts

  • Develop a real-time intent framework using tools like 6sense to notify sales teams of high-potential leads.
  • Create CRM or Slack-based smart alerts and scoring logic to surface next-best-action insights.

Remote Compensation Philosophy

Remote’s Total Rewards philosophy is to ensure fair, unbiased compensation and fair equity pay along with competitive benefits in all locations in which we operate. We do not agree to or encourage cheap-labor practices and therefore we ensure to pay above in-location rates. We hope to inspire other companies to support global talent-hiring and bring local wealth to developing countries.

At first glance our salary bands seem quite wide – here is some context. At Remote we have international operations and a globally distributed workforce. We use geo ranges to consider geographic pay differentials as part of our global compensation strategy to remain competitive in various markets while we hiring globally.
The base salary range for this full-time position is $56,900-$192,050. Our salary ranges are determined by role, level and location, and our job titles may span more than one career level. The actual base pay for the successful candidate in this role is dependent upon many factors such as location, transferable or job-related skills, work experience, relevant training, business needs, and market demands. The base salary range may be subject to change.

At Remote, we foster internal mobility as a key element of our culture of employee growth and development, supported by a compensation philosophy that guarantees pay equity and fairness. Therefore, all compensation changes associated with an internal move will be reviewed by the Total Rewards & People Enablement team on a case by case basis.
